Many characters who interact with Hyde take on animal characteristics. Hydes vicious, almost feral side is most pronounced in the scene where he beats an old man who stops him in the street and politely asks for directions: Mr. Hyde broke out of all bounds and clubbed him to the earth. Frequent shifting from loving to hating is a manifestation of the defense called splitting, first coined by Freud. They claim to love Dr. Jekyll and hate Mr. Hyde but dont see their partner as the same person.
